Are you a highly organised administrator who enjoys being the person a busy team can rely on?
We are recruiting for a Administrator to join a successful, employee-owned business based in Woking. This is a varied, behind-the-scenes administration role where you'll become an important part of a close-knit team, providing day-to-day support and helping to keep projects, schedules and administration running smoothly.
As an employee-owned business, there is a real emphasis on teamwork and everyone playing their part in the continued success of the company. They are therefore looking for someone with a positive attitude who is happy to get stuck in, take ownership and become a trusted and dependable member of the team.
This is primarily an office-based administrative position rather than a telephone-heavy or client-facing role. You'll work closely with the contracts team and provide key support behind the scenes, so excellent attention to detail, organisation and the ability to pick up new systems quickly are essential.
Key Responsibilities
- Provide day-to-day administrative support to the contracts team
- Coordinate subcontractors, temporary staff and site schedules
- Assist with arranging site visits, inspections and follow-up works
- Arrange plant and equipment hire and waste collections where required
- Maintain accurate records and update internal systems
- Prepare, update and organise project paperwork and documentation
- Assist with RAMS and other project-related documentation
- Liaise with suppliers and subcontractors
- Keep schedules and project information accurate and up to date
- Support the team with general administration and ad hoc requirements
- Help ensure deadlines are met and nothing gets missed
